Being charged with a crime is a serious matter. A conviction can result in the loss of liberty, a fine, the forfeiture of property, the loss of voting rights, the exclusion from certain types of work, the denial of certain licenses, and the loss of the right to purchase and possess firearms. For immigrants, a criminal conviction can lead to deportation. Even the conviction of a minor crime can impair your future job or educational prospects.
